Getting to Machu Picchu

How does one get to the iconic Machu Picchu site? The 2-day tour from Cusco includes efficient transportation to reach this ancient wonder. Travelers start with a van ride to Ollantaytambo, then board a train to Aguas Calientes. Finally, they take a 30-minute bus up the winding road to the Machu Picchu entrance.

| Transportation | Duration |

| — | — |

| Van to Ollantaytambo | 2 hours |

| Train to Aguas Calientes | 2 hours |

| Bus to Machu Picchu | 30 minutes |

Exploring the Inca Citadel

Upon arriving at the Machu Picchu site, the guided tour explores the key features of this iconic Inca citadel.

Visitors marvel at the Guardian House, an important administrative building. Next, they wander through the circular tower, a sacred astronomical observatory. The sundial, carved into the stone, aligns with the sun’s position to mark the solstices.

At the Temple of the Condor, ancient stone carvings depict the revered bird. Lastly, the Temple of the Three Windows offers stunning panoramic views of the surrounding Andes mountains.

The guided tour provides insight into the civilization that constructed this architectural wonder.
